Villarreal head into the final game of the Primera Division season knowing they cannot be budged from their eight-placed finish in the table.

The Yellow Submarine have just missed out on qualification for Europe.

Osasuna, meanwhile, will finish solidly midtable.

Osauna current form

Without nothing much to play for at the business end of the campaign, Osasuna have largely been poor over the last few weeks.

They impressively emerged victorious against Atletico Madrid last week, but prior to that they went on a run of six games without a win and lost four of those against Valencia, Rayo, Granada and Betis.

Villarreal current form

Villarreal, on the other hand, have enjoyed a positive bit of form with three wins, a loss and a draw in their last five.

The loss came in a 3-2 defeat against Celta, while the victories were against Rayo, Sevilla and Girona.

Last weekend, they took part in a hugely entertaining clash against Real Madrid which ended 4-4, with star striker Alexander Sorloth scoring four.

Osasuna vs Villarreal Team News

David Garcia, David Garcia and Kike Barja are all definitely out for Osasuna.

Alfonso Pedraza, Juan Foyth and Denis Suarez are out for Villarreal, while Yeremy Pino is still battling to get back to fitness. He hasn't played since November and is unlikely to be risked on the final day.

Scoreline Prediction

Villarreal have been solid recently, while their four-goal haul against Madrid last week is not to be sniffed at.

Osasuna 1-2 Villarreal
